Smartphone prices come crashing down

It’s the midway mark of the Gitex Shopper and smartphone prices are the first to plummet with LG, BlackBerry, Sony Xperia, Samsung, among others, marking a significant drop.

LG G3 has dropped by almost Dh500. The device, which was priced at Dh2299 across all retailers when the show started is now selling for Dh1799. Whats more, you also get accessories as bundle offers.

The BlackBerry Q10 model, which was retailing at Dh1,049 at the beginning of the Shopper has dropped by Dh100 at both the company’s stand and One Mobile. Certain other stores have dropped the prices by an additional Dh150. You can now buy a BlackBerry Q10 at the Gitex Shopper for as low as Dh825.

Meanwhile, the Q5, which was being retailed at Dh799 has also dropped further to Dh674.

The Z3 also has witnessed a price drop of Dh100 to sell for Dh799 across various retailers, while the older BlackBerry 9720 is now for Dh574 from Dh649.

You can also get a BlackBerry Q10 for as low as Dh349 but with not one but two Etisalat postpaid plans with a monthly commitment of Dh100 and for a minimum of four months. Each plan comes with 1 GB monthly data and 300 flexible minutes.

When asked why someone would buy two SIM cards when the Q10 is not a dual SIM phone, the retailer said, “This is the plan if you want the device for Dh349,” he said. With a similar postpaid plan you also get a Z3 for Dh49.

In yet another major drop the Sony Xperia Z Ultra LTE is selling for Dh1,099 at Sharaf DG, a drop of more than 50 per cent. The device was priced at Dh2,199 before the Shopper. It also comes with a bundle offer that includes a Manchester City headphone.

“Yesterday alone we sold more than 100 units. We have a little more than 100 units remaining,” one of the promoters said.  The model is already out of stock with other retailers.

Meanwhile, at Jumbo you can get a Samsung Galaxy S5 for Dh1999, while the dual SIM S5 Duos is priced at Dh2199. Hunt harder at other venues and you might even find a Samsung S5 Duos for much cheaper. We found one retailer selling five remaining S5 Duos at just Dh1700.

E-City is running a similar price drop deal on the popular Samsung Note 3 LTE, with a price drop averaging Dh300 for the phone to retail now for Dh2,099, which is bundled further with a digital camera and a Samsung audio dock worth Dh799.

The Note 3 3G is retailing for Dh1,999, which also comes with a digital camera, plus a power bank and a selfie stick.

Another major drop in prices is on the Nokia Lumia 1520. Jacky’s is offering a 32” LCD and the smartphone along with a 500 GB hard disk and several other gadgets as bundle for Dh1799.
